Card text
Batroc the Leaper card

Batroc the Leaper

{1} {R}
Legendary Creature — Human Villain
Multikicker {2} (You may pay an additional {2} any number of times as you cast this spell.) Batroc enters with a +1/+1 counter on him for each time he was kicked. When Batroc enters, he deals damage equal to his power to each of up to X targets, where X is the number of times he was kicked.
2 / 2
Marvel Super Heroes Commander (MSC) · Rare · Illustrated by Lucio Parrillo

How is Playgroup Live card data collected?
Players using Playgroup Live import their decklists before a game and log card actions as they play. Each cast, zone change, and resolution is recorded as a real game event. Stats on this site are computed from those events, not from decklist scrapes or theorycrafting. Playgroup has recorded 670,000+ Commander games overall, and this card-level play data comes from the Playgroup Live subset of that corpus.
